Output 31b66930c5fd78001e53910526b89bf99deae2bdb7cccd24bc1be1357b417d99:21

value
4244
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fe8597bfe2e6ddfa348a97a4e96029f13bc1b3b47bc23b0b95482355ac2d79e3
address
bc1pl6ze00lzumwl5dy2j7jwjcpf7yaurva500prkzu4fq34ttpd083s55msva
transaction
31b66930c5fd78001e53910526b89bf99deae2bdb7cccd24bc1be1357b417d99
spent
true